Maintaining your new look at home
Home maintenance is a key part of extending the life of sew-in hair extensions. Use sulphate-free shampoos and gentle brushing techniques to minimise shedding and tangling. Avoid sleeping with tight ponytails or heavy products that can pull on the bonds. Regularly detangling and conditioning the mid-lengths helps preserve the blend and keeps the weave looking natural. If you notice lift or discomfort at the bonds, it’s wise to book a quick check-in with your stylist to adjust the fit and keep strands secure.

Choosing a maintenance plan that suits you
Different clients require different schedules for upkeep. Some prefer a fuller, more voluminous look with monthly adjustments, while others may opt for lighter fills every six to eight weeks. A personalised plan should cover wash routines, styling tips, and bond checks to prevent damage. The right approach balances aesthetic goals with your hair’s health, hair growth cycle, and lifestyle, ensuring the style remains flattering without compromising scalp and strand integrity.
